vue 传对象 页面跳转_vue具体页面跳转传参方式

本文详细介绍了在Vue中如何进行页面跳转以及参数传递,包括使用`localStorage`进行数据存储和读取,以及`vue-router`的`params`和`query`传参方式。同时提到了微信小程序的页面跳转传参方法和JavaScript静态页面跳转的实现。此外,还讨论了不同框架如AngularJS中使用`service`进行状态管理来传递参数。
摘要由CSDN通过智能技术生成

1.写数据,可以使用“.”,”[]”,以及setItems(key,value);3种方式。

例如:

localStorage.name = proe;//设置name为" proe "

localStorage["name "] = " proe";//设置name为" proe ",覆盖上面的值

localStorage.setItem("name"," proe ");//设置name为" proe "  推荐使用setItem();

2.读数据,可以使用“.”,”[]”,以及getItems(key);3种方式。例如:

var  a = localStorage["name"];              //获取name的值

var  b = localStorage. name;                 //获取name的值

var  c = localStorage.getItem("name ");   //获取name的值 ,推荐使用setItem();

ps:由于LocalStorage是存储到硬盘上的,如果我们不主动清理那么数据会永久保存到硬盘上,清理方式:localStorage.removeItem("name");如果希望一次性清除所有的键值对,可以使用clear();

H5有个key()方法,可以在不知道有哪些键值的时候使用。

var storage = window.localStorage;

function showStorage(){

for(var i=0;i

//key(i)获得相应的键,再用getItem()方法获得对应的值

document.write(storage.key(i)+ " : " + storage.getItem(storage.key(i)) + "
");

}

}

localStorage与sessionStorage存储的必需是字符串,而获取的交互数据是Object,所以我们一般要把JSON格式的字符串转成字符。

JSON.stringify()将Json对象转为字符串。

JSON.parse()将字符串转为json格式。

微信小程序页面跳转传参方式

//实现跳转的A页面 jump: function () { let a = 1; let b = 2; wx.navigateTo({ url: '/page/vipOrder/vipOrder?d ...

小程序页面跳转传参-this和that的区别-登录流程-下拉菜单-实现画布自适应各种手机尺寸

小程序页面跳转传参 根目录下的 app.json 文件 页面文件的路径.窗口表现.设置网络超时时间.设置多 tab { "pages": [ "pages/index/i ...

vue 页面跳转传参

页面之间的跳转传参,正常前端js里写 window.location.href="xxxxx?id=1" 就可以了: 但是vue不一样 需要操作的是路由history,需要用到 V ...

Vue之路由跳转 传参 aixos 和cookie

一.路由跳转 1.1 项目的初始化 vue create m-proj   >>>创建vue项目 精简vue项目的 views 视图   About(基本是删除的) Home.(可以 ...

js实现静态页面跳转传参

最近有个项目: 存静态web服务,一个新闻页面列表出所有新闻摘要信息,然后通过点击新闻详情访问到该新闻的详情页面: 新闻展示的页面通过ajax请求接口获取到新闻的摘要信息,预计想通过id的方式访问到新 ...

【转】request和response的页面跳转传参

下面是一位园友的文章: jsp或Servlet都会用到页面跳转,可以用 request.getRequestDispatcher("p3.jsp").forward(request ...

angularjs不同页面间controller传参方式,使用service封装sessionStorage

这里分享一个我在实际项目中,使用service封装的一个依赖sessionStorage的传参服务. 这里先说下大背景,在我们的实际开发中,登陆之后一般会存在一个token,这个token将会贯穿全场 ...

vue页面跳转传参

跳转页 this.$router.push({name:'路由命名',params:{参数名:参数值,参数名:参数值}}) 接收页 this.$route.params.参数名

微信小程序页面跳转传参

1.传递参数方法   使用navigatior组件

随机推荐

java发送http的get、post请求

转载博客:http://www.cnblogs.com/zhuawang/archive/2012/12/08/2809380.html Http请求类 package wzh.Http; impor ...

Java设计模式-原型模式(Prototype)

原型模式属于对象的创建模式.通过给出一个原型对象来指明所有创建的对象的类型,然后用复制这个原型对象的办法创建出更多同类型的对象.这就是选型模式的用意. 原型模式的结构 原型模式要求对象实现一个可以“克 ...

TJOI2015 day1解题报告

博客园的编辑器真的是太蛋疼了= =,想用tex然后上jpg又贴不了链接,真的很纠结啊= = T1:[TJOI2015]线性代数 描述:戳上面吧= = 首先这道题我觉得是这套题最漂亮的一道题了(虽然说学 ...

BroadcastReceiver工作过程

动态注册过程: ContextWrapper.registerReceiver--> ContextImpl.registerReceiver--> ContextImpl.registe ...

【算法】CRF(条件随机场)

CRF(条件随机场) 基本概念 场是什么 场就是一个联合概率分布.比如有3个变量,y1,y2,y3, 取值范围是{0,1}.联合概率分布就是{P(y2=0|y1=0,y3=0), P(y3=0|y1= ...

lucene基础

同一个域中,即使相同的单词,如出现两次JAVA,也是不同的token,但他们对应相同的term,在term中记录这些token信息 数据库数据,与luence数据 需要搜寻(也即索引)的field,存 ...

详解 HTML5 中的 WebSocket 及实例代码-做弹幕

原文链接:http://www.php.cn/html5-tutorial-363345.html

Centos7 docker 常用指令

Docker 运行在 CentOS 7 上,要求系统为64位.系统内核版本为 3.10 以上 一.docker的安装及卸载 1.查看当前系统内核版本: [root@docker ~]# uname - ...

zeromq 笔记

一. 当执行zmq_bind后会进入mute state,直到有进入或者出去的连接发生才会进入ready state 在mute state状态下会根据不同的套接字类型决定是丢弃消息还是阻塞 可参考z ...

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值